Job Description

AECOM is seeking a Landscape Architect or Designer for immediate employment in our Los Angeles studio. This is an opportunity to join a multi-disciplinary practice focused on high-performing landscapes that tackle climate change, interconnectivity and mobility, smart growth, ecological systems, and natural resources. Our studio designs a broad range of urban public realm projects including streetscapes, parks, ecological restoration, and green infrastructure. We are looking for a passionate designer who is energized by a collaborative design process that engages colleagues, clients, and the communities we serve.

Job Summary/Responsibilities

Play an active role in the design process from concept through construction
Preparing design graphics and technical drawings
May coordinate design and administrative activities with employees in other disciplines and other departments participating on an assigned project.
May assist in the training assigned architectural and design/drafting personnel.
Under the direction of the Supervising Landscape Architect, may independently perform technical assignments of various complexities within approved schedules and budgets

Qualifications:
Qualifications

Minimum Requirements

4 years of professional Landscape Architecture experience or demonstrated equivalency of experience of education.
Landscape Architecture degree (BLA/BSLA/MLA) from an LAAB accredited institution

Preferred Qualifications
Strong interpersonal skills and excellent graphic, verbal, and written communication skills
Self-motivated with the ability to proactively solve challenges
Proficiency in AutoCAD, Adobe Creative Suite, MS Office Suite, hand drawing
Proficiency in 3D modeling (Rhino3D)
Desire and ability to integrate seamlessly into both landscape architecture and multi-disciplinary design teams.
Ability to effectively manage multiple projects, prioritize tasks, and self-edit work
A commitment to design excellence and a passion for building a better world.
Licensed Landscape Architect or actively pursuing licensure
LEED GA/AP, SITES AP, ENV SP, and/or DBIA credentials
Familiarity with Southern California and/or Pacific Northwest native and climate-appropriate plant communities
Experience with advanced modeling and analysis software (e.g. Revit, Grasshopper3D, ArcGIS)
Experience with MicroStation and DOT-related construction documentation
Experience with Design-Build project delivery
Experience with RFP/RFQ processes for public agencies, institutions, organizations, and private entities
